
MySQL,作为一款开源的关系型数据库管理系统(RDBMS),因其稳定性、灵活性和高效性,成为众多开发者和企业的首选数据库解决方案
将 Python 与 MySQL 结合使用,能够极大地提升数据管理和处理能力
本文将详细介绍如何在 Python 3.7 环境下安装和配置 MySQL,以及如何使用 Python 连接和操作 MySQL 数据库
一、安装 Python 3.7 首先,确保你的系统上已经安装了 Python 3.7
如果尚未安装,可以通过以下步骤进行安装: 1.访问 Python 官网:打开浏览器,访问 【Python 官方网站】(https://www.python.org/downloads/)
2.下载 Python 3.7 安装包:在“Downloads”页面,选择适合你的操作系统的安装包
例如,对于 Windows 用户,下载 Windows x86-64 executable installer;对于 macOS 用户,可以选择 macOS 64-bit installer
3.运行安装包:下载完成后,双击安装包并按照提示完成安装过程
在安装过程中,建议勾选“Add Python 3.7 to PATH”选项,以便在命令行中直接使用 Python 命令
4.验证安装:安装完成后,打开命令行工具(Windows 的 cmd 或 PowerShell,macOS 的 Terminal),输入`python --version` 或`python3 --version`,检查是否输出`Python 3.7.x`,以确认安装成功
二、安装 MySQL 接下来,我们需要在系统上安装 MySQL
安装步骤因操作系统而异: Windows 系统: 1.下载 MySQL 安装包:访问 【MySQL 官方网站】(https://dev.mysql.com/downloads/installer/),下载 MySQL Installer for Windows
2.运行安装程序:双击安装程序,选择“Custom”或“Developer Default”安装类型,以便自定义安装组件
3.选择组件:在组件选择界面,确保选中 MySQL Server、MySQL Workbench(可选,用于数据库管理)、MySQL Connector/Python(用于 Python 连接 MySQL)
4.配置 MySQL Server:安装 MySQL Server 时,会提示进行配置
设置 root 密码、选择默认字符集(通常选择 utf8mb4)等
5.安装并启动服务:完成配置后,点击“Execute”开始安装
安装完成后,MySQL 服务将自动启动
macOS 系统: 1.使用 Homebrew 安装:macOS 用户推荐使用 Homebrew 进行安装
首先,如果尚未安装 Homebrew,可以打开终端并运行以下命令安装 Homebrew: bash /bin/bash -c$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/HEAD/install.sh) 2.安装 MySQL:安装 Homebrew 后,在终端中运行以下命令安装 MySQL: bash brew update brew install mysql 3.启动 MySQL 服务:安装完成后,启动 MySQL 服务: bash brew services start mysql 4.安全配置:运行 `mysql_secure_installation` 命令,设置 root 密码并进行其他安全配置
Linux 系统(以 Ubuntu 为例): 1.更新软件包列表: bash sudo apt update 2.安装 MySQL Server: bash sudo apt install mysql-server 3.启动 MySQL 服务: bash sudo systemctl start mysql 4.设置开机自启: bash sudo systemctl enable mysql 5.安全配置:同样运行 `sudo mysql_secure_installation` 命令进行安全配置
三、安装 MySQL Connector/Python 无论在哪个操作系统上,安装完 MySQL 后,下一步是在 Python 环境中安装 MySQL Connector/Python,这是官方提供的 Python 驱动,用于连接和操作 MySQL 数据库
1.打开命令行工具:确保你使用的是 Python 3.7 对应的命令行环境
2.使用 pip 安装:运行以下命令安装 MySQL Connector/Python: bash pip install mysql-connector-python 或者,如果你使用的是 Python 3 的专用 pip 版本(在某些系统上可能是`pip3`): bash pip3 install mysql-connector-python 四、使用 Python 连接 MySQL 安装完成后,我们可以编写 Python 脚本来连接 MySQL 数据库并执行 SQL 语句
以下是一个简单的示例: python import mysql.connector from mysql.connector import Error try: 建立数据库连接 connection = mysql.connector.connect( host=localhost, 数据库主机地址 database=test_db, 数据库名称 user=root, 数据库用户名 password=your_password 数据库密码 ) if connection.is_connected(): print(成功连接到 MySQL 数据库) 创建一个游标对象 cursor = connection.cur
MySQL高效批量更新索引技巧
Python3.7安装MySQL教程指南
MySQL安装后快速重置密码指南
Python实战:轻松更新MySQL数据库中的某一列数据
MySQL升级后忘记密码解决指南
MySQL端口未监听?排查启动问题
MySQL与Zabbix面试高频题解析
MySQL高效批量更新索引技巧
MySQL安装后快速重置密码指南
Python实战:轻松更新MySQL数据库中的某一列数据
MySQL升级后忘记密码解决指南
MySQL端口未监听?排查启动问题
MySQL与Zabbix面试高频题解析
虚拟机安装MySQL数据库指南
MySQL服务崩溃,重启难题解析
Win系统下MySQL外部访问设置指南
MySQL8SSL:加强数据库安全,掌握SSL加密技术新趋势
MySQL内存数据优化实战指南
MySQL错误262解决方案速览